There are several definitions of 3PL. Third party logistics (3PL) is a company that provides an all-encompassing service to its customers of outsourced logistics services for a part or all of their supply chain management functions. All of your logistics requirements should be taken care of with a full-service 3PL.

Outsourcing logistics processes can be an effective means of managing the needs of your organization. However, when you decide to take the jump to outsourcing, you will have to choose between an asset-based and non-asset-based third-party logistics provider (3PL). Both types of 3PLs have advantages and disadvantages.
